Maharashtra: Thane crosses 30,000 corona cases

| @indiablooms | Jun 29, 2020, at 09:12 am

Thane/UNI:  With addition of 1,345 new corona positive cases here in a single day on Sunday, the district's tally surged to 30,289, the reports from the district headquarters said.

Among the new positive patients, Kalyan-Dombivili recorded the highest of 369 cases, followed by Thane-341, Navi Mumbai-197, Mira-Bhayandar-116 and Ulhasnagar-101.

The total number of positive cases reported across the district were as such Thane city-8,168, Navi Mumbai-6,200, Kalyan-Dombivili-5,678 and Mira Road-Bhayander-3,015.

The report also said that 36 deaths due to the pandemic were reported across the district, including 14 in Thane alone, pushing the toll to 983.

The recovery rate in the entire district was 47.84 per cent and the mortality rate stood at 3.25 per cent today.

In the district the highest recovery rate of 62.96 per cent was reported in Mira Road-Bhayander while the highest mortality rate of 5.75 per cent was recorded in Bhiwandi.
Meanwhile, the neighbouring Palghar district reported total 4,244 positive cases and 120 deaths till date, the reports from the district stated.
